>> Actually I got a job which contains several small jobs inside.
>> 
>> if run the bash script, it will do those one by one and it is pretty
>> slow, waiting ...
>> 
>> I can run each small jobs separately, but use a bash script kind of
>> easy to make some changes in amount and manage.
>> 
>> I just wonder are there some simple way to do it?
> 
> What you could try is converting your bash script to a makefile, you can
> then let make do the work of parallelizing your jobs with "make -j 8 -f
> yourmakefile".
